Following on from a period of e-mail correspondance between M4URM and myself, I'm pleased to report that the matter has now been resolved. :j
It is regretful that the first person who answered my call and initially dealt with my complaint was so unhelpful and seemed to be 'stone-walling' me-hence my anger and frustration
Since then though 'Ruth' at the company has done her best for me and has personally taken charge of following up my initial complaint :T
My revised opinion of this firm for anyone considering using them is that you should try and take a screenshot of your price (plus any voucher if applicable) and always get proof of posting using recorded delivery....!
That way, if there are any issues apparent these can be used to support your case!
(I have posted this in the interests of fairness to all parties....)0 -

They offer slightly more than all the others but this is a con as they tell you that your phone (returned in their envelope) was water damaged when it was in A1 condition when sent..
Just a warning for other potential customers, I sent off 3 phones in the same jiffy bag and 2 of them were paid the correct amount for. However, phone 3 - a K750i in full working order - wasn't paid for. After waiting 3 days for a reply, they advised me:

:T sent M4URM a working w910i beginning of last week, just checked my bank account and they have paid me £45.50 within 7 days of me posting - i used their freepost bag they sent me, took it to post office and it cost me 70p to send it recorded (this covered me upto a value of £39 - nearly what the phone was worth) i had no problems with them at all. ii would use this service again as they pay more than i would get from ebay and i dont have to pay fees :T0
